    [tools] Add inline_pom.py script for development
    
    Adds inline_pom.py, which can be run as
    
        inline_pom.py fe/pom.xml java/**/pom.xml
    
    to perform environment substitution. This makes POM files usable by
    VSCode and in remote development where environment variables may not be
    available to IDE language servers and other features.

+# This script can be used to inline environment variables in pom.xml
+#
+# Usage: inline_pom.py <pom.xml>...
+
+import re
+import sys
+from tempfile import mkstemp
+from shutil import move, copymode
+from os import fdopen, remove, getenv
+
+env_pattern = re.compile(r"\$\{env\.[^}]*\}")
+
+
+class colors:
+  HEADER = '\033[95m'
+  WARNING = '\033[93m'
+  ENDC = '\033[0m'
+
+
+def inline_envs(line):
+  envs = env_pattern.findall(line)
+  for env in envs:
+    name = env[6:-1]
+    value = getenv(name)
+    print("{}={}".format(name, value))
+    if value:
+      line = line.replace(env, value)
+  return line
+
+
+def update_pom(pom_path):
+  fd, new_path = mkstemp()
+  with fdopen(fd, 'w') as new_file:
+    with open(pom_path, 'r') as old_file:
+      for line in old_file:
+        new_file.write(inline_envs(line))
+
+  copymode(pom_path, new_path)
+  remove(pom_path)
+  move(new_path, pom_path)
+
+
+if __name__ == "__main__":
+  if len(sys.argv) < 2:
+    print("Usage: inline_pom.py <pom.xml>...")
+    sys.exit(1)
+
+  print("{}Replacing environment variables in {}{}"
+      .format(colors.HEADER, ', '.join(sys.argv[1:]), colors.ENDC))
+  print("{}WARNING: avoid committing updated POM files.{}"
+      .format(colors.WARNING, colors.ENDC))
+  for pom_path in sys.argv[1:]:
+    update_pom(pom_path)
